park ranger spent $208 to buy 12 trees.Redwood trees cost $24 each and spruce trees cost $16 each. How many of each tree did the park ranger buy? Answer: The park ranger bought 2redwood trees and ______ spruce trees

Answer:

The park ranger bought 2 redwood trees and 10 spruce trees.

Step-by-step explanation:

24 * 2 = 48

208 - 48 = 160

160 / 16 = 10
